Output 0c8524e2ed7566f29d70590b29d0ff39d36c86dead14b98fd5ed4b8be9e08b8a:2

value
692991723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ef153079348081d810284e74ccee72f248d99811 OP_EQUAL
address
3PVAoeq4QKNYEP97RyrzkqyAYEQgqymmZW
transaction
0c8524e2ed7566f29d70590b29d0ff39d36c86dead14b98fd5ed4b8be9e08b8a
spent
true